A long cruise across the wide open spaces of Montana was the order of the day… We covered 109 miles and 2600 feet. Most of the climbing was in the morning and the rest of the day was flat with very gradual downhill lots of wind 15 minutes before we arrived at the hotel the skies opened up with the torrential rain, which was our first rain of the trip.
In the lead up to lunchtime, we had an awesome pace-line of 11 of us going along at 20 miles an hour just eating up the distance. And to our left a herd of horses got stirred up to pursue us on the other side of the road - check out the videos!
